Key Innovations Presented in CanvasSoft’s Latest Release
| Feature | Description | Industry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Enhanced AI Integration | Leveraging machine learning to facilitate automatic brush strokes and colour blending, dramatically reducing artist workload. | Redefining creative processes by enabling faster prototyping and iteration cycles. |
| Real-Time Collaboration | New cloud-enabled features allow teams across different geographies to co-create seamlessly. | Promotes remote teamwork, essential in post-pandemic creative industries. |
| Advanced Textures & Materials | Fidelity improvements in texture mapping for hyper-realistic digital content. | Bridges the gap between digital and traditional media, empowering artists to craft more convincing visual assets. |
| User Interface Overhaul | Sleeker, more intuitive controls designed based on comprehensive user feedback. | Reduces onboarding time, enabling more rapid adoption among professionals. |
Industry Insights: Why the Software Market Is Ripe for Disruption
According to recent industry reports, the global digital content creation market is projected to grow at an annual rate of 8.2% over the next five years, reaching over $13 billion by 2028 (Statista, 2023). As this demand accelerates, the significance of timely, innovative updates—such as CanvasSoft’s new release—becomes apparent.

Expert Perspectives: Evolving Skills and Technological Synergies
Leading industry voices emphasise that the integration of advanced features into creative software is not merely about adding bells and whistles but about empowering users with tools that adapt to their workflows. AI-driven automation, in particular, aligns with trends observed in data-driven art, augmented reality (AR), and virtual reality (VR) content development. These innovations contribute to a paradigm shift where artists are free to focus more on conceptual design while relying on software to handle technical subtleties.
Moreover, comparisons across the leading platforms reveal that those investing heavily in AI and collaborative infrastructure are better positioned to capture market share among professional and semi-professional creators (Creative Tech Journal, 2023).
